目录

Glide做了哪些优化

Glide做的优化有:1、图片缓存;2、图片压缩;3、图片优化;4、图片加载顺序。Glide 是由3dfx公司开发的Voodoo系列专用的3D API。它是名列前茅个PC游戏领域中得到广泛应用的程序接口,它的最大特点是易用和稳定。

一、Glide做的优化

1、图片缓存

Glide提供了三级缓存机制,分别是内存缓存、磁盘缓存和网络缓存。内存缓存可以快速加载图片,磁盘缓存可以在应用程序下次启动时快速加载图片,网络缓存可以减少数据流量的使用。通过三级缓存机制的合理配置,可以提高图片加载的效率。

2、图片压缩

Glide会根据ImageView的大小和屏幕分辨率等因素自动调整图片的压缩比例,从而减少图片占用的内存空间,降低内存的使用量。同时,Glide还可以支持WebP格式的图片加载,WebP格式可以更好地压缩图片,从而减少网络流量的使用。

3、图片优化

Glide会根据ImageView的大小和屏幕分辨率等因素自动调整图片的大小,从而减少图片的占用空间。同时,Glide还可以对图片进行格式转换,从而使图片更适合在特定设备上使用。

4、图片加载顺序

Glide会自动根据ImageView的位置和屏幕分辨率等因素调整图片的加载顺序,从而保证用户看到的图片是优异质的。